Output 21ccd76571a2501f6ae34036b44a0d94bfbb60c9e44b00f2886c3f1a0ee58434:1

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1ae20117a2f3159ac5930d7e950011d59654d6e OP_EQUALVERIFY OP_CHECKSIG
address
1P2tSffytFZxnhBHKpTDdZSnEv85n4ftao
transaction
21ccd76571a2501f6ae34036b44a0d94bfbb60c9e44b00f2886c3f1a0ee58434
spent
true